Permission for retention for the change of use and internal alterations

Refused

Core Refusal Reason

Failure to justify the requirement for a detached residential unit and lack of evidence regarding the suitability of the existing wastewater treatment system.

Decision Maker's Conclusion

  • The applicant failed to provide a justification for a detached rather than an attached self-contained unit or identify the specific family member for whom the accommodation is required.
  • The proposal is contrary to Section 18.13.3 of the Wexford County Development Plan 2013-2019 and the proper planning of the area.
  • The absence of information regarding the condition and capacity of the existing effluent treatment system presents an unacceptable risk to public health.

Decision Document Summary

The application sought retention permission for the change of use and internal alterations of a structure to a self-contained residential unit at Kilmichael, Kilgorman. The local authority refused the proposal primarily because the applicant did not demonstrate why a detached unit was necessary instead of an attached 'granny flat' extension, nor did they provide details on the intended occupant.
